The Song in your Heart

-

Psalm 42 vs 11

“Why, my soul, are you downcast? Why so disturbed within me? Put your hope in God, for I will yet praise him, my Savior and my God.”

I had the opportunit­y to watch a kaleidosco­pe of artistes who recently released a music album. There was a brief write up about each artiste, including when they last produced commercial work for release.

As I read through the stories of the various artistes what stood out for me was the fact that yesteryear’s stars were still alive. Some of them were now very old but what was amazing was that despite the passage of time they were still producing music.

One of the artistes had last produced an album 20 years ago, it’s now a different era altogether but you could feel their resilient spirit. The years may have taken their toll on the artiste and their physical appearance has changed over time, but they still desire to remain current and relevant.

God planted that spirit in all of us, we desire to hold on to life, live it to the fullest and never stop trying until the very last minute. Regardless of age we all want to continue living and remain relevant.

Have the issues of life left you feeling a little tired and worn out? Don’t give up. God did not put a spirit of giving up in us, He created us to celebrate life and more importantl­y to keep pushing for something better. Hold on to this desire and never give up, He will see you through.

Hold on to the music in your heart, find new inspiratio­n and never stop singing His praises.

Be blessed.
